14:22 — Points ledger on Perchly started double-crediting referrals. Turns out the retry worker replayed acked messages after the queue failover. We froze accruals at 14:40, reconciled overnight, nobody lost points (some briefly gained, now clawed back). Dedup keys ship this sprint. The replay batch is traceable via the token below.

pipeline stamp: htk31_f769b577b3028a4e9958e5bb8d1259a

## Cutover: user module extraction

Freeze writes to `users` in Kestrelbase monolith at T-0. Deploy `userc-svc` v1.4 to the Veldmoor cluster. Run dual-write verifier; abort if drift >0.1%. Flip router flag `USERC_PRIMARY`. Rollback window: 30 min. Artifacts must be signed before the deploy gate accepts them. Only the release manager signs. Sign with the release deploy key below.

signing key of bagap-yawep = bky13_TbfT6ZMUoGJo2

The Nightloom scheduler accepts POST requests to enqueue backfill windows, validates date ranges against the Cinderbrook catalog, and rejects overlapping jobs with a 409. All endpoints require authenticated calls; anonymous requests are dropped at the gateway. For this week's sync demo, authenticate your requests using the shared staging credential shown below.

portal login ticket: eyJhbGciOiJIUzI1NiIsInR5cCI6IkpXVCJ9.eyJzdWIiOiI0Z4ywpUMsBIn0.ca5FVhkdBXa3

The renewal of our three-year agreement with Torvane Materials has been assessed in detail. Proposed terms include a 4.2% unit-price increase, partially offset by improved volume rebates and extended payment terms of sixty days. Sensitivity analysis indicates a net annual cost impact of under 1% on the Meridia product line, assuming stable demand. Legal has flagged no material changes to liability clauses. We recommend approval, subject to the conditions outlined in the confidential note below.

confidential, yawip-bahif: Zorokox Partners plans to lower the Casax list price by 28.0 percent in April. The board signed off on a budget of $271.0 million for Project Juldor. The renewal with Pelokox Partners closes at $410.1 million a year, 3.4 percent below the last contract. Project Pelok slips by a full year because of the audit delay.